The final day will start with the women's marathon at 11:30 AM in the morning. Athletes will race across a challenging yet scenic course which stretches to 42 kms. It will be followed by the men's handball bronze medal match between Spain and Slovenia starting at 12:30 PM.
Another big match will be between USA and Italy for the women's handball gold medal. The match will begin at 4:30 PM. After all the international events today, it will be time for the closing ceremony which is scheduled for 12:30 AM (Aug 12).
